C语言 从键盘输入一个小于1000的正数,要求输入他的平方根(如平方根不是整数,则输入其整数部分)
来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/10/04 20:57:42
C语言 从键盘输入一个小于1000的正数,要求输入他的平方根(如平方根不是整数,则输入其整数部分)
输入数据后先对其检查是否为小于1000的正数,若不是,则重新输入.
#include
#include
int main()
{
int x,y;
printf("输入一个小于1000的整数x",x);
scanf("%d",&x);
if(x0)
{y=sqrt(x);
printf("x平方根的整数部分是y",x,y);
}
else
{printf("输入的数据不符合要求,重新输入一个小于1000的整数x",x)
scanf("%d",&x);
y=sqrt(x);
}
return 0
}
E:\实验4\实验4-2.c(6) :error C2018:unknown character '0xa3'
E:\实验4\实验4-2.c(6) :error C2018:unknown character '0xbb'
E:\实验4\实验4-2.c(7) :error C2146:syntax error :missing ';' before identifier 'scanf'
E:\实验4\实验4-2.c(9) :warning C4244:'=' :conversion from 'double ' to 'int ',possible loss of data
E:\实验4\实验4-2.c(14) :error C2146:syntax error :missing ';' before identifier 'scanf'
E:\实验4\实验4-2.c(15) :warning C4244:'=' :conversion from 'double ' to 'int ',possible loss of data
E:\实验4\实验4-2.c(18) :error C2143:syntax error :missing ';' before '}
输入数据后先对其检查是否为小于1000的正数,若不是,则重新输入.
#include
#include
int main()
{
int x,y;
printf("输入一个小于1000的整数x",x);
scanf("%d",&x);
if(x0)
{y=sqrt(x);
printf("x平方根的整数部分是y",x,y);
}
else
{printf("输入的数据不符合要求,重新输入一个小于1000的整数x",x)
scanf("%d",&x);
y=sqrt(x);
}
return 0
}
E:\实验4\实验4-2.c(6) :error C2018:unknown character '0xa3'
E:\实验4\实验4-2.c(6) :error C2018:unknown character '0xbb'
E:\实验4\实验4-2.c(7) :error C2146:syntax error :missing ';' before identifier 'scanf'
E:\实验4\实验4-2.c(9) :warning C4244:'=' :conversion from 'double ' to 'int ',possible loss of data
E:\实验4\实验4-2.c(14) :error C2146:syntax error :missing ';' before identifier 'scanf'
E:\实验4\实验4-2.c(15) :warning C4244:'=' :conversion from 'double ' to 'int ',possible loss of data
E:\实验4\实验4-2.c(18) :error C2143:syntax error :missing ';' before '}
printf("输入一个小于1000的整数x",x);x不需要,改成
printf("输入一个小于1000的整数:");
printf("输入的数据不符合要求,重新输入一个小于1000的整数x",x)同理也改
return 0 前加
printf("平方根或平方根的整数部分为%d\n",y);
printf("输入一个小于1000的整数:");
printf("输入的数据不符合要求,重新输入一个小于1000的整数x",x)同理也改
return 0 前加
printf("平方根或平方根的整数部分为%d\n",y);
C语言 从键盘输入一个小于1000的正数,要求输入他的平方根(如平方根不是整数,则输入其整数部分)
C语言 从键盘输入一个小于1000的正数,要求输入他的平方根,如平方根不是整数,则输入其整数部分.
从键盘输入一个小虞1000的正数,要求输出它的平方根(如平方根不是整数,则输出其整数部分).要求在输入
从键盘输入一个小虞1000的正数,要求输出它的平方根如平方根不是整数,则输出其整数部分.要求在输入数输
从键盘输入一个小于1000的正数,要求输出它的平方根(如平方根不是整数,则输出其整数部分).
C语言编程.从键盘输入一个小于1000的正数,要求输出它的平方根(如果平方根不是整数,则输出其整数
用C怎么表示从键盘里面输入一个小于一千的正数,要求输出他的平方根(如果不是整数输出整数部分)要求在输
c语言!大家看看我哪里错了?输入小于1000正数,输出它的平方根,平方根不是整数输出其整数部分!
c语言 编写程序,从键盘输入一个整数,计算并输出它是几位数.若输入的是负数时,要求重新输入.
C语言用户输入一个整数,打印从1到该整数的平方根和立方根表,保留3位小数
C语言 编写程序,从键盘输入一个正数,计算该数的平方根.
c语言求解.从键盘输入一个正整数N,再输入N个整数,按从小到大的顺序输出.